Transaction 8c52bb33394af33586b1bb9a8f23ca30112eed66617c94036d15900453ffa80e
1 Input
1 Output
-
8c52bb33394af33586b1bb9a8f23ca30112eed66617c94036d15900453ffa80e: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c6b26fbf0387b9ea077e115e7b9893483df12665a0b57dd6341ad2fb89eda100
- address
- bc1pc6exl0crs7u75pm7z908hxynfq7lzfn95z6hm435rtf0hz0d5yqqmm09l5